The Norwegian Radium Hospital is located on the westside of Oslo, a few kilometers from the city centre. To get to the city centre of Oslo from the Gardermoen airport, take the airport train ('flytoget') (takes about 20 minutes) to the Oslo Central Station ('Oslo S') or the National Theatre ('Nationalteateret'). From these stations you can take the subway line no. 3, in direction Kolsås, to the Montebello station (takes about 10 minutes), which is close to the Radium Hospital (see map below). Of course, you can also take a taxi from the Central Station or the National Theatre directly to the Radium Hospital (takes about 10 minutes).
We have appointments with two hotels: The Rainbow Hotel Europa is located a 5-minutes walk from the National Theatre Station, whereas the Rainbow Gyldenløve Hotel is located a 10-minutes walk from the Majorstua Station, which is the next stop after the National Theatre with any of the subway lines (see maps below, the Gyldenløve Hotel is labelled with a red H).
